Size: a a a

2018 November 05

V

Valentin in БЭМ
На каком камне вырезаны правильные последовательности или ответ скрыт в звездом небе? Сегодня пасмурная ночь, из-за облаков не видать адекватной разработки? >.<
источник

V

Valentin in БЭМ
Кто как решает эту проблему? Запоминаете все импорты в каждом файле и слеедуете данной сортировке или выстраиваете по алфавиту в надежде, что каскады стилей не перезатрут соседние стили?
источник

НП

Никита Плотников in БЭМ
Valentin
У этого вообще есть объяснение? Такое ощущение, что конфликтуют импорты одних и тех же вызовов бем блоков в разных бандлах. Как такое вообще решается?
mini-css-extract-plugin предупреждает, что файлы в твоем чанке импортируют css в разном порядке, что может привести к результату, который ты не ожидал
источник

V

Valentin in БЭМ
это я понял, но что тогда эталонный порядок?
источник

НП

Никита Плотников in БЭМ
просто везде должен быть одинаковый порядок, например, по алфавиту
источник

V

Valentin in БЭМ
я так выставил, не помогло.
источник

V

Valentin in БЭМ
Пока был один большой бандл (прим `OmsPage`) все было ок. Но стоит создать второй бандл и импортировать хоть в том же самом порядке, те же самые файлы. Он начинает сыплить эти варнинги. Я.. Я просто не понимаю
источник

НП

Никита Плотников in БЭМ
источник

НП

Никита Плотников in БЭМ
ишью по этой теме
источник

V

Valentin in БЭМ
читал, только потом решил спросить у вас
источник

S🌍

Sv 🌍 in БЭМ
источник
2018 November 06

И

Илья in БЭМ
Привет всем! Как тут с именованием?
источник

И

Илья in БЭМ
мне говорят что так дожно быть? почему? panel-body через дефис, ведь это вложенный элемент и он зависит от panel
источник

И

Ильдар in БЭМ
class="panel__body status__panel-body"
источник

И

Ильдар in БЭМ
Илья
мне говорят что так дожно быть? почему? panel-body через дефис, ведь это вложенный элемент и он зависит от panel
👆
источник

И

Ильдар in БЭМ
если блок panel-body то так "panel-body status__panel-body"
источник

И

Илья in БЭМ
логично что bodу отедельно от panel не существует значит должно быть panel__body
источник

И

Ильдар in БЭМ
Илья
логично что bodу отедельно от panel не существует значит должно быть panel__body
если у васоно не выделенно отдельным блоком, то как эдмент panel это будет panel__body
источник
2018 November 11

EG

Ekaterina Gerasimova in БЭМ
Привет!
Вопрос: как сочетать использование css-препроцессора и организацию файловой структуры по бэм?

есть файл, в котором определены переменные (например, цвета), который хотелось бы подключить для всех scss/less/styl файлов
как соблюсти принцип, что каждый блок является самостоятельной единицей, и не должен зависеть от окружения?
источник

AY

Alexey Yarrr (qfox) in БЭМ
Просто при сборке подключать его первым всегда
источник